Razzle-dazzle (noun) Definition, Meaning & Examples

noun Informal.
  1. showiness, brilliance, or virtuosity in technique or effect, often without concomitant substance or worth; flashy theatricality: The razzle-dazzle of the essay's metaphors cannot disguise its shallowness of thought.
  2. deceptive action typically consisting of a series of complex maneuvers, as a double reverse or hand-off, usually executed in a flashy manner: a team relying more on power and speed than razzle-dazzle.
  3. confusion, commotion, or riotous gaiety: He thrived on the lights, the crowds, the razzle-dazzle of the Las Vegas Strip at night.
adjective
  1. impressively opulent or decorative, especially in a new way; showy; flashy; eye-catching: a shopping center lined with razzle-dazzle boutiques.
  2. energetic, dynamic, or innovative: razzle-dazzle technology; a razzle-dazzle sales pitch.
